Vietnamese[edit]

Etymology[edit]

From Proto-Vietic *muːs (nose), from Proto-Mon-Khmer *muh ~ *muuh ~ *muus (nose); cognates include Khmer ច្រមុះ (crɑmoh), Bahnar muh, Khasi khmut, Mon မိုဟ်, Car Nicobarese meh.

For the sense of "cape", compare the development of English ness, Bulgarian нос (nos).

Noun[edit]

(classifier cái) mũi (𪖫, 𪖬, )

  1. (anatomy) nose
  2. (nautical) prow, bow

Noun[edit]

mũi (, )

  1. (of a needle/knife/sword/lance/spear) tip

Noun[edit]

mũi (, )

  1. (geography) cape
    mũi Hảo Vọngthe Cape of Good Hope

Classifier[edit]

mũi (𪖫, 𪖬, )

  1. injection with a syringe; shot
    tiêm mũi thứ 2to get the 2nd shot
